DIVISION-MIDWAY ALLIANCE FOR COMMUNITY IMPROVEMENT is a based in PORTLAND, OR, focused on Community Improvement, Capacity Building causes , specifically Economic Development. Established in December 2013, it operates as an independent corporation and contributions to this organization are tax-deductible .
With total assets of $1,587,649.00, this ranks 170,397 among 2,656,690 nonprofits nationally (Top 7%), demonstrating substantial financial capacity relative to its peers. At the state level, it stands at 2,249 out of 36,951 organizations in OR (Top 7%).
In multnomah county, OR, the organization ranks 747 out of 8,061 nonprofits by assets (Top 10%), while locally in portland, it stands at 782 among 8,470 organizations (Top 10%).
The organization reported annual revenue of $1,022,998.00, ranking 124,441 nationally (Top 5%) and 1,943 in OR (Top 6%).
Within its specific NTEE classification (S30 - S: Community Improvement, Capacity Building), which includes 4,887 similar organizations, DIVISION-MIDWAY ALLIANCE FOR COMMUNITY IMPROVEMENT ranks 494 in assets (Top 11%) and 429 in revenue (Top 9%).
The organization files a 990 (all other) or 990EZ return and operates on a May fiscal year.
